  • Patent number: 9646082
    Abstract: To facilitate legal research, companies, such as Thomson West provide subscription-based online information-retrieval systems. Seeking to improve these and/or related systems, the present inventors devised, among other things, an exemplary legal research system that performs a conventional search to identify a set of starter documents and then leverages the metadata associated with these starter documents to identify another larger set of relevant documents. Documents in this alternate set are then scored using, for example, a learning machine and feature vectors that account for metadata relationships between the starter documents and alternate documents.

  • Patent number: 9607303
    Abstract: A system, architecture and model for facilitating extensible messaging and interaction are provided. The message system may use a messaging architecture that includes a domain message model, and open message model and a wire format. The wire format may implement primitive data types that may be used by the open message model to define additional and/or more complex data formats. The open message model may further specify interaction paradigms, generic messages, and message and transport attributes. The generic messages may include payload data whose meaning and context may be defined using the domain message model. The domain message model may include a content definition model and an item type model for building data and object types and specifying data context and relationships. As such, the message system may use generic messages and formats to create different message and item types.

  • Patent number: 9600509
    Abstract: To facilitate access to public records, the present inventors devised, among other things, an entity resolution system. The exemplary system includes master records database of 300 million entities, which is partitioned into multiple distinct portions. The exemplary system extracts entity information from input public records and constructs one or more blocking queries against specific portions of the master records database to identify one or more sets of candidate records. Feature vectors are defined for the candidate records and machine learning techniques, such as Support Vector Machine, are used to determine which of the candidate records from the master records database match the input public records. Candidate records that match are logically associated with public records, enabling ready access via direct or indirect queries.

  • Patent number: 9552420
    Abstract: Systems and techniques are disclosed to rank documents by analyzing a query log generated by a search engine. The query log includes data relating to user behavior, queries and documents. The systems and techniques distill query log information into surrogate documents and extract features from these surrogate documents to rank the documents.
